On 10/20/2022 7:53 AM, Muhammad Husaini Zulkifli wrote: > From: Vinicius Costa Gomes <vinicius.gomes@intel.com> > > The I225 hardware has a limitation that packets can only be scheduled > in the [0, cycle-time] interval. So, scheduling a packet to the start > of the next cycle doesn't usually work. > > To overcome this, we use the Transmit Descriptor frst flag to indicates > that a packet should be the first packet (from a queue) in a cycle > according to the section 7.5.2.9.3.4 The First Packet on Each QBV Cycle > in Intel Discrete I225/6 User Manual. > > But this only works if there was any packet from that queue during the > current cycle, to avoid this issue, we issue an empty packet if that's > not the case. Also require one more descriptor to be available, to take > into account the empty packet that might be issued. > > Test Setup: > > Talker: Use l2_tai to generate the launchtime into packet load. > >
